MPS.py is a compilation of algorithms for Master Production Schedule:
- One Time run
- Chase (Lot for Lot)
- Fixed Order Quantity
- Periodic Order Quantity
- Silver-Meal Heuristic
- Wagner-Whitin Optimization

You can either run the script as a standalone program or as a module
Master Production Schedule
positional arguments:
fcost The fixed cost
hcost The holding cost
demands Demands during each period
optional arguments:
-h, --help show this help message and exit
-v, --verbose Print information during process
-e, --excel Write Final DataFrame to excel
$ python MPS.py 500 1.5 150 50 150 200 50 250 50 200 50 100 50 300
